模組化計算工具鏈庫
資料工具一個用於計算化學應用的 Fortran 函式庫,提供統一的分子結構數據處理和多種幾何格式的 I/O 功能。
此 GitHub 開源專案 grimme-lab/mctc-lib 是一個模組化計算工具鏈庫,使用 Fortran 語言開發。根據 README 說明,它提供統一的分子結構數據處理功能,支援讀取和寫入超過十二種不同的幾何格式,包括通用 ASCII 格式(如 xyz、PDB)、JSON 格式(如 QCSchema、Chemical JSON)和特定程序格式(如 Turbomole、Vasp)。此外,庫還包含元素數據(如原子半徑、電負性)和協調數計算工具,適用於計算化學應用。專案提供詳細的錯誤訊息和支援多種建構系統如 meson、CMake 和 fpm,方便開發者集成和使用,適合計算化學研究者進行分子結構數據的 I/O 操作和數據處理。